What Type of Metal Is Used in Metal Buildings?

Not all metal buildings are created equal. The type of metal used plays a major role in cost, durability, and maintenance requirements.

Steel: The Primary Material in Metal Buildings

Most metal buildings are constructed using high-quality steel due to its exceptional strength and resistance to environmental factors. Steel is highly durable, recyclable, and capable of withstanding extreme weather conditions, making it the preferred material for commercial, industrial, and residential applications.

Aluminum vs. Steel: Which Is More Cost-Effective?

While aluminum is sometimes used in smaller structures, steel is the go-to choice for most metal buildings. Here’s why:

  • Cost: Steel is more affordable per square foot than aluminum, making it the better choice for budget-conscious projects.
  • Strength: Steel is significantly stronger than aluminum, providing better structural integrity for larger buildings.
  • Longevity: Steel resists corrosion and wear over time, requiring less maintenance than aluminum in most climates.

For those looking for the best combination of affordability and durability, steel buildings are the clear winner.

How Do Metal Buildings Compare to Traditional Construction?

Traditional construction methods, such as wood or concrete buildings, have been the norm for centuries. However, when it comes to cost, efficiency, and long-term value, metal buildings consistently outperform them.

Material Costs: A Clear Advantage

Wood and concrete have long been used for construction, but rising material costs have made them less economical. Wood is becoming increasingly expensive, and it requires additional treatment to prevent pest infestations and rot. Concrete, while durable, is costly due to the labor-intensive installation process.

Steel, in contrast, offers affordability without sacrificing durability. It is readily available, easy to transport, and requires fewer materials to construct a sturdy building. These factors contribute to its lower overall cost.

Faster Construction, Lower Labor Costs

Traditional buildings require extensive framing, specialized labor, and longer construction times, all of which add to the cost. Wood structures need carpenters, and concrete buildings require skilled masons and additional drying time before completion.

Metal buildings, however, come pre-engineered, meaning the components are fabricated in a factory and arrive ready for assembly. This approach reduces labor requirements, shortens construction time by up to 50%, and significantly cuts labor costs.

Superior Durability with Less Maintenance

Durability is another area where metal buildings outshine traditional construction. Wood is vulnerable to termites, moisture damage, and warping, leading to frequent repairs. Concrete, while strong, can crack over time, requiring costly maintenance.

Steel buildings, however, are resistant to pests, mold, and weather-related damage. With galvanized or coated finishes, they resist rust and corrosion, further reducing maintenance costs. This long-term durability translates to substantial savings over time.

Energy Efficiency and Cost Savings

One of the hidden advantages of metal buildings is their energy efficiency. Steel structures can be designed with superior insulation, reducing heating and cooling costs.

How Metal Buildings Lower Energy Bills

  • Reflective Roofing: Metal roofs reflect sunlight, keeping interiors cooler in summer.
  • Insulation Options: High-quality insulation minimizes heat loss in winter.
  • Sealed Construction: Precision engineering reduces air leaks, enhancing efficiency.

Compared to traditional buildings, steel structures require less energy to maintain comfortable indoor temperatures, leading to significant cost savings over time.

Minimal Maintenance Costs

Unlike wood or concrete, metal buildings require very little maintenance. This results in long-term savings that make them even more affordable.

Why Metal Buildings Need Less Maintenance

  • Rust and Corrosion Resistance: Galvanized or coated steel prevents rust, even in harsh weather.
  • Pest Resistance: No risk of termites, rodents, or mold, reducing repair costs.
  • Weather Durability: Steel withstands heavy snow, strong winds, and even earthquakes better than traditional materials.

With fewer maintenance concerns, businesses and homeowners save thousands of dollars over the lifespan of their buildings.
